Toronto, ON – The Canadian Barista & Coffee Academy, Canada’s premier specialty coffee education center, continues to lead the way in barista training and coffee business education nationwide. Established in 2001, the Academy is dedicated to raising the standard of coffee excellence in Canada through world-class instruction, hands-on workshops, and industry-certified courses.
Located in the heart of Toronto’s coffee community on Bloor Street West, the Academy offers a unique curriculum designed for aspiring baristas, café owners, and coffee enthusiasts alike. Courses cover everything from beginner espresso training and advanced latte art to comprehensive business seminars on how to open and run a successful coffee shop.
“Our mission has always been education-focused,” said a spokesperson from the Academy. “We are not a café or equipment distributor. We are a fully independent training facility dedicated to helping people learn the science, art, and business of coffee.”
What sets the Canadian Barista Academy apart is its team of highly experienced instructors, including national barista champions, certified SCA trainers, roasters, and café consultants. Students benefit from real-world expertise, professional feedback, and industry-standard practices designed to elevate both skill and confidence.
In addition to barista training, the Academy plays a vital role in developing Canada’s coffee culture. It launched the country's first coffee magazine and coffee and tea trade show and continues to support barista competitions and educational forums nationwide.
For entrepreneurs entering the coffee industry, the Academy’s Coffee Business & Café Startup Workshops offer insider insights into café planning, budgeting, menu design, and operational success. The “bean to cup” approach helps students gain both theoretical and practical knowledge, empowering them to thrive in a competitive market.
With courses running regularly in Toronto and Vancouver, and flexible online options available, the Canadian Barista Academy is expanding access to quality coffee education for professionals coast to coast.
